Abstract

The article examines modern media discourse in a manipulative aspect as a translator of a new reality. The research materials were polycode texts as carriers of a complex type of coded information (news segment, social advertising), collected by continuous sampling and dedicated to the global eventuality – the COVID-19 pandemic. The study revealed that the modeling of the leading attitudes of the ideology of power, the formation and broadcasting of a new moral and cognitive paradigm, the corresponding behavioral models in media discourse is carried out using a conflict-generating (manipulative) strategy and a number of tactics (fragmentation, generalization, hyperbolization, silence, repression, unity etc.), explicated at the pragmatic level, as well as with the help of linguistic resources. In the process of modeling the principles of the leading ideology (the concept of power), the alternative discourse remains outside the framework of the official mass media (broadband information space) and is pushed into the digital virtual space of the media environment. As a result of the interpretation of the collected material, it turned out that the following are becoming the leading mechanisms for modeling power discourse: implicit - presupposition (creating a false presupposition against which tactics are used), the interference of different semiotic codes, as well as reformatting the content of the conceptual opposition, one's own – someone else's; explicit – means of metagraphics (punctuation marks, font, size, color design, location of informative fragments) and linguistic resources proper (precedent phenomena, conceptual metaphor, nature of subject nomination, etc.).
